**NATURE & SCOPE**
The Program Coordinator - Aquatics is responsible for the planning and development of all aquatics
programs, while ensuring the growth and retention of membership through provision/delivery of service
excellence.
**RESPONSIBILITIES:
- **
Responsible for organizing an efficient swim program in accordance with the YMCA of Niagara
Guidelines and Practices, Ontario Health Regulations and TSSA Standards.
- Engages with members to optimize their experience in achieving aquatic goals in order to
maximize retention.
- Develop and sustain good member, volunteer, staff and partner relations on a daily basis.** -**
Assess conflict situations and exercises good judgment in recommending** **solutions.** -**
Ensure that program areas are staffed accordingly to quickly and efficiently serve members. Act as
a back‐up instructor as required.** -**
Plan and manage departmental budget.** -**
Human resource management of the staff/volunteer team (recruitment/selection, training,
coaching, performance management, recognition).** -**
Work as a member of the senior staff team to support Branch operations (duty manager
responsibilities) and Association initiatives.** -**
Understand and support YMCA philanthropic initiatives.
- Monitor commitment to service excellence by role modelling and maintaining YMCA SAM 2.1
standards.
- To be responsible for the safety and security of members and participants.
- Ensure that program areas are kept safe, clean and organized.
- Adhere to the YMCA Child Protection Policies and Procedures as established by the YMCA of
Niagara.
**QUALIFICATIONS
- **
Post-secondary diploma or degree.
- Current National Lifeguard certification.
- Current YMCA Swim Instructors or equivalent, and LSS Lifesaving Instructors.
- YMCA Canada Aquatic Fitness certification or equivalent is preferred.
- Bronze Cross Examiners are an asset and will be required.
- Minimum 5 years’ experience in an aquatics environment.
- Minimum 3 years staff/volunteer supervisory experience.
- Current Standard First Aid/CPR[C]- must be a certificate that meets the Health Regulations (St.
John’s, Red Cross, Life Saving Society or Ski Patrol).
- A clear and satisfactory criminal reference check inclusive of the vulnerable sector search (CRC
VSS) issued for the YMCA of Niagara.
